Sir Alan Parker
British film director Sir Alan Parker has always held strong views on the future of the film industry. In this digital age, are movies as central to our culture as they used to be?
Sir Alan Parker is one of Britain's most experienced and successful film directors. His work ranges from the stomach churning realism of Midnight Express to the feel good entertainment of Bugsy Malone and Fame. He has never cared much for film critics and has always held strong views on the future of the film industry - in this digital age, are movies as central to our culture as they used to be?
